Describe a place that you have been to that has a lot of water.
You should say:
where this place is
what people do at this place
why you went there
and explain whether you like this place or not.
My hometown is famous for springs. In the centre of our city, there are a group of springs located together. They all flow into one lower pool. People name it Black Tiger Spring. It has become a symbol for my city and attracted crowds of local citizens and tourists.
Summer is the best time to visit the spring, especially on a hot day, because spring water makes the air cool down, plus there are trees providing shelters. All these have contributed to the popularity of this place. People living nearby like to come to fetch spring water. Its also a paradise for fishing lovers. Old men could spend a whole morning there fishing. They seem to enjoy themselves a lot. At weekends, English learners come and get together to have English corner. Calligraphy lovers practice writing characters on the ground with a huge brush pen and spring water as ink.
A few decades ago, there were even more springs flowing. For one time, the rapid developing industries consumed a lot of water. Some springs therefore become dry. However, in recent years, the local government has been working on reconstructing the citys underground water system to make dried springs flow again. They did a good job. Springs now come back into our life.
I was there last July. It rained slightly that day, which made the trip kind of romantic, as you could see rain needles dipping into the water surface. I walked along the pool, feeling so peaceful in mind. I like the place, and I will go there again.

Water Usage
Do you think people use more water today than they did before ?
I think so. First of all, industry is the largest user of water. We are now having more industries. Industry requires a great amount of water. So, more water is being used. The second largest user of water is domestic use. People use more, drink more, and most sadly, waste more.
Do you think its important to try to save water?
It is of vital importance for human beings to save water. We need water our lives depend on it. We all know that the worlds population is getting larger day by day. More water is being consumed. At the same time, there are many places on this world where people are suffering from lack of drinking water. Water is a precious resource. It is urgent to save water from being wasted.
How can people save water?
Water conservation has two aspects: one, use water efficiently so that there is enough for the needs of all living things; two, keep freshwater clean, so that it can continue to support life on Earth. As an ordinary citizen, I appreciate what my family does in saving water. We reuse used water. Its simple. Ive always believed that if every family devotes its own effort, water saving will no longer be a mission impossible.
What are the main ways that water is used in the home?
In the home we use water to brush teeth, to take a bath, to flush toilets, to wash face and hands, to wash dishes and clothes, to shave legs, to prepare food and clean up, and to drink.
Water Resources
What water resources do you think are most important for protection and conservation?
Freshwater is most important for protection and conservation . More than two thirds of the Earth is covered by water but less than 1% is freshwater 97% is too salty and the rest is ice. No one would disagree with me on this issue. I am sure about this. Obviously, without water, people cannot live.
What measures do you suggest the government could do to protect these resources?
Government should make laws against water wasting and pollution. As for factories, they should be forbidden from pouring industrial waste into rivers. Otherwise they will get sever punishment . It is the governments responsibility to educate the community about how to save water and encourage consumers to be water efficient in the home and garden, in business and at school.
Is the way people use water today the same as the way people used to use water, say, 50 years ago?
I should say NO. In the past, water doesnt seem to be a problem. People dont usually suffer from lack of fresh water. But now it is a problem. As a result, people are becoming increasingly conscious of water being a precious resource. Water-saving washing machines have been produced; the idea of water recycling gets popular among families; water-saving is seen as a good virtue.
What are the reasons for water shortages in China?
There are both geographical and humans reason for water shortage in parts of China. Geographically, there is imbalance among areas in terms of rainfall. Places with less rainfall are more likely to suffer from water shortage. For the human beings part, big cities with large population consume huge amount of water every day. This could cause water shortage, too.
